Каждый сайт в интернете размещается на сервере — компьютере, который постоянно подключен к сети и доступен для посетителей круглосуточно. Серверы в свою очередь размещены в датацентрах, имеющих мощные каналы подключения к интернету, защиту от различных атак, а также надежную систему резервного питания и защиту от внештатных ситуаций.
Хостинг – это услуга аренды ресурсов (дисковых, процессорных и памяти) на таком сервере, которая необходима для размещения сайта в сети Интернет. Без хостинга сайт существует только локально на вашем компьютере и недоступен никому другому. Хостинговые компании обычно также оказывают техническую поддержку своим клиентам, что позволяет создавать и размещать сайты и интернет даже неопытным пользователям.
Как хостинг работает:
Когда посетитель вводит адрес вашего сайта в браузер, происходит следующее: браузер обращается к DNS-серверам, чтобы найти IP-адрес сервера, где хранится сайт. Затем посылает запрос на этот сервер. Сервер обрабатывает запрос, выполняет код сайта (PHP, Perl, Phython или другой), обращается в базу данных и возвращает готовую HTML-страницу. Браузер получает ответ от сервера и отображает страницу посетителя.
Весь этот процесс занимает доли секунды. От того, какое оборудование и программное обеспечение использует хостинг-провайдер, а также насколько хорошо оптимизирован ваш сайт зависит скорость ответа сервера, стабильность работы и максимальная нагрузка, которая может выдержать ваш сайт.
Что обычно входит в услугу хостинга:
| Параметр | Значение | Объяснение |
|---|---|---|
| Дисковое пространство | Место для файлов | Файлы сайта, изображения, базы данных, почтовые ящики |
| Трафик (Bandwidth) | Передача данных | Объем данных, передаваемых посетителям в месяц |
| CPU и RAM | Вычислительные ресурсы | Ресурсы необходимы для выполнения PHP, Perl, Python и других скриптов |
| База данных | MariaDB/MySQL/PostgreSQL | Сохранение контента сайта |
| SSL-сертификат | HTTPS-шифрование | Необходимо для шифрования при передаче данных от сервера к пользователю. |
| Панель управления | cPanel, DirectAdmin и другие | Веб-интерфейс для управления всеми ресурсами |
| Поддержка | Техническая помощь | Качественная и быстрая техническая поддержка является важным фактором при выборе хостинга |
Типы хостинга:
Сегодня на рынке хостинга присутствуют решения для проектов любого масштаба — от личного блога до глобальных платформ с миллионами пользователей. Рассмотрим самые распространенные из них:
Виртуальный хостинг (Shared Hosting):
Виртуальный хостинг или общий хостинг (Shared Hosting) – самый распространенный и доступный тип хостинга. На одном физическом сервере размещаются десятки или сотни сайтов разных клиентов. Все они разделяют общие ресурсы: процессор, оперативную память и диск.
Как это работает:
Провайдер устанавливает панель управления (cPanel, DirectAdmin или другую) и изолирует аккаунты клиентов между собой – каждый видит только свои файлы и базы данных. Настройка сервера, обновление серверного программного обеспечения, безопасность, стабильная работа и мониторинг всех сервисов провайдер берет на себя.
Для кого подходит виртуальный хостинг:
• Личные блоги.
• Корпоративные сайты-визитки.
• Небольшие интернет-магазины.
Как выбрать качественный виртуальный хостинг:
Ищите провайдеров с NVMe-дисками, поддержкой PHP 8.1+, включенным OPcache и гарантированным и четким количеством ресурсов CPU/RAM/Disk (а не просто неограниченным хостингом). Отзывы клиентов и uptime-гарантия – важные индикаторы качества.
Реселлерский хостинг (Reseller Hosting):
Реселлерский хостинг позволяет купить большой пакет ресурсов у провайдера и перепродавать их собственным клиентам как отдельные хостинг-аккаунты. Технически это shared-хостинг, но с расширенными правами управления. Реселлер сам может создавать отдельные хостинговые аккаунты на сервере и управлять их ресурсами в пределах своего тарифного плана.
Особенности:
• Панель управления двух уровней: админский (WHM для cPanel) и клиентский (cPanel).
• Возможность создавать собственные тарифные планы с разными лимитами ресурсов.
• Возможность управления DNS, почтой и SSL для всех клиентов централизована.
Для кого подходит:
• Веб-студии, предоставляющие клиентам хостинг вместе с разработкой сайтов.
• Фрилансеры, управляющие хостингом нескольких клиентов.
• Маленькие хостинг-провайдеры, начинающие бизнес.
Ответственность перед клиентами:
В качестве реселлера вы отвечаете за uptime и качество услуги перед своими клиентами — даже если проблема на стороне вашего провайдера. Выбирайте надежного провайдера с оперативной поддержкой.
Виртуальный Частный Сервер (VPS):
VPS (Virtual Private Server) – виртуальный сервер с гарантированными ресурсами. На одном физическом сервере с помощью специального ПО (KVM, VMware, OpenVZ) создается несколько изолированных виртуальных машин. Каждая получает свой процессор, память, диск и операционную систему — независимо от других.
Для кого подходит:
• Бизнес-сайты со средним трафиком.
• Интернет-магазины с большим каталогом и WooCommerce.
• Проекты, требующие специфического ПО: Redis, Elasticsearch, Node.js.
• Разработчики, которым нужна тестовая среда.
• Агентства, желающие полный контроль над сервером для нескольких клиентов.
VPS требует технических знаний:
В отличие от shared-хостинга, VPS без панели управления требует базового знания Linux: настройки веб-сервера, файервола, обновлений безопасности. Если нет опыта — либо установите панель управления (DirectAdmin, cPanel), либо выберите Managed VPS, где провайдер берет администрирование на себя.
Выделенный сервер (Dedicated Server):
Выделенный сервер – это аренда целого физического сервера, все ресурсы которого принадлежат только вам. Никакой виртуализации, никаких соседей. Максимальная производительность и полный контроль железа.
Когда требуется выделенный сервер:
• Большой трафик.
• Ресурсоемкие задачи: видеотрансляция, большие вычисления, ML-модели.
• Жесткие требования к безопасности и соответствию: финансовые, медицинские данные.
• Специфические аппаратные требования: большой объем RAM, NVMe SSD, CPU или даже GPU
Как и с VPS, если у вас нет опыта администрирования серверов, это не проблема, ведь обычно хостинговые провайдеры предоставляют такую услугу.
Облачный хостинг (Cloud Hosting):
Облачный хостинг – это инфраструктура, где ресурсы предоставляются из пула физических серверов и масштабируются динамически. Вместо одного физического сервера ваш сайт может использовать ресурсы десятков или сотен машин и платите вы только за фактическое потребление.
Ключевые преимущества облака:
Масштабируемость. Ресурсы увеличиваются автоматически при возрастании нагрузки и уменьшаются, когда оно спадает. Ваш сайт не ляжет во время пикового трафика (например, после публикации вирусного материала или распродажи).
Высокая доступность. Данные реплицируются между несколькими физическими серверами. Если один узел выходит из строя – трафик автоматически переключается на другой.
Для кого подходит:
• Проекты с непредсказуемым или сезонным трафиком.
• Глобальные продукты с аудиторией в разных странах.
• Высокозагруженные системы, где количество посетителей может достигать десятки или сотни тысяч посетителей .
• Проекты, требующие микросервисной архитектуры и контейнеризации (Docker, Kubernetes).
С чего начать:
Не нужно сразу покупать мощный выделенный сервер для нового проекта. Начните с качественного вируального или VPS хостинг. Следите за использованием ресурсов. Когда проект начнет расти и ресурсов не будет — мигрируйте. Переезд между типами хостинга технически не сложен. Кроме того, наша команда всегда поможет с иммиграцией.
На что обращать внимание при выборе провайдера:
Технические параметры:
• SSD или NVMe-диски — значительно быстрее HDD. Это базовое требование в 2024 году.
• Версия PHP – провайдер должен поддерживать PHP 8.1+ и давать возможность выбирать версию.
• OPcache или другие модули модуля — должен быть включен или доступен для включения.
• Поддержка HTTP/2 — стандарт для современных веб-серверов.
• Uptime – гарантия доступности 99.9%
Сервисные параметры:
• Расположение дата-центра
• Качество поддержки – время ответа и компетентность команды. Читайте отзывы.
• Резервное копирование — есть ли автоматические бекапы и как легко восстановить их.
• Миграция – поможет ли провайдер перенести сайт бесплатно.
• Репутация и возраст компании — существующие 10+ лет провайдеры обычно надежнее.
Подсчитаем:
Хостинг – не просто «место для сайта». Это инфраструктура, которая определяет скорость, стабильность и безопасность вашего онлайн-присутствия. Правильно выбранный хостинг остается незаметным, сайт всегда доступен и быстро загружается. Неверно избранный становится источником неизменных заморочек.
Для большинства проектов путь выглядит так: начинаете с качественного виртуалного-хостинга → переходите на VPS когда растете → рассматриваете выделенный сервер при серьезном масштабе. Не нужно сразу прыгать на дорогие решения — важно иметь четкий план, когда и куда двигаться дальше.